/

主页
分享互联网新闻

微信小程序怎么单独登陆

更新时间:2025-07-11 00:26:02

微信小程序是微信生态系统中的一项重要功能,它允许用户无需下载和安装传统应用即可使用各种服务与功能。对于开发者和用户而言,微信小程序的便捷性是吸引他们的重要因素之一。然而,在很多情况下,用户可能需要在没有登录微信账号的情况下,单独登录某些微信小程序。这种需求可能源自多个场景:比如,用户希望仅仅在某个小程序内完成特定操作,而不希望被微信账号绑定,或者出于隐私、安全等方面的考虑,选择仅限小程序内部的登录。

1:为什么要进行单独登陆?

首先,探讨为什么微信小程序会有“单独登陆”的需求。简单来说,微信小程序本身是依赖于微信账户进行用户身份认证的,但有些情况下,开发者或用户可能希望提供一种无需全程微信账户绑定的便捷登录方式。比如,对于某些不涉及个人信息的场景,用户可能更倾向于临时登录,避免长时间暴露自己的微信账号信息。

此外,很多小程序涉及到业务或服务的跨平台操作,因此用户或开发者可能希望在多个设备或环境下使用同一个小程序而不依赖于微信账号的绑定。此时,小程序的单独登陆机制便显得尤为重要。

2:如何在微信小程序中实现单独登录?

要实现微信小程序的单独登录,有几种不同的方式。这些方法依据微信提供的API接口和用户的具体需求而有所不同。以下是一些常见的方式:

2.1:使用自定义登录功能

对于开发者而言,可以通过微信小程序的开放接口结合自身业务需求,实现自定义的登录流程。具体来说,可以利用微信的wx.login() API获取用户的临时登录凭证。然后,通过这个临时凭证,开发者可以向自己的后台服务器请求用户的唯一身份标识(如openID)。有了openID后,开发者就可以为用户提供一个相对独立的小程序登录状态,而不需要微信账号的直接绑定。

2.2:使用第三方授权登录

如果小程序是跨平台或第三方服务的延伸,开发者可以选择集成第三方登录功能。通过集成常见的OAuth 2.0授权协议,开发者可以允许用户使用如QQ、微博等社交账户进行登录。微信本身并未直接提供“单独登录”的功能,但通过集成这些外部授权服务,用户就可以在不通过微信直接绑定的情况下,完成小程序登录。

2.3:简化版用户信息收集

有些情况下,小程序仅需要一个简单的登录流程,用户的基本信息即可进行个性化服务。这种情形下,可以通过手机号验证码登录,利用微信的wx.getUserInfo()接口来获取一些基础信息,而不强制要求微信账号登录。通过这种方式,用户的微信账号并不会直接与小程序绑定,既保持了登录的便利性,也满足了用户隐私的需求。

3:单独登录的安全性与隐私问题

当然,任何涉及用户登录的操作都必须考虑到安全性和隐私保护。单独登录的实现,特别是在不使用微信账号的情况下,可能会面临一些安全挑战。

3.1:用户数据保护

在用户进行单独登录时,开发者必须确保所采集的用户数据得到妥善保护。例如,手机号、验证码等信息应当经过加密处理,避免信息泄露。同时,开发者应根据相关法律法规(如《个人信息保护法》)处理用户数据。

3.2:登录信息的存储与管理

对于开发者而言,单独登录后获取的用户信息需要在后台系统中存储并管理。这就要求开发者建立健全的用户身份管理体系,确保用户登录后的状态在小程序内外的一致性。此外,还需要设计合适的登录过期机制和定期验证策略,以防止用户信息被滥用。

4:常见问题与解决方案

4.1:单独登录失败怎么办?

有时,微信小程序在尝试实现单独登录时,可能会遇到登录失败的情况。这可能是因为临时登录凭证无效、服务器接口未正确对接,或者用户设备出现了网络问题。解决方案是:首先检查微信API是否被正确调用;其次,确保后端服务器能够正确验证登录凭证;最后,建议开发者对可能出现的错误做详细的日志记录,以便排查问题。

4.2:如何处理用户未登录的状态?

如果用户未进行登录,或因某些原因中断了登录,应该在小程序内设计清晰的引导流程。通常的做法是,当用户尝试访问需要登录的页面时,弹出提示框或弹出窗口,要求用户完成登录操作,确保体验的连贯性。

4.3:如何实现跨设备的单独登录?

如果用户希望在不同的设备上使用相同的小程序账号,可以通过在后台生成统一的设备标识符,确保用户在不同设备间的登录状态得以同步。此外,开发者还可以使用短信验证码、邮箱验证码等方式,提供跨设备登录的可能性。

5:总结

微信小程序的单独登录功能,虽然没有直接的官方支持,但通过灵活运用微信提供的API接口、第三方授权等方式,开发者仍然可以为用户提供一个独立于微信账号的登录机制。无论是基于隐私、跨平台需求,还是为了简化用户体验,单独登录的实现都具有重要的意义。然而,开发者在实现这一功能时,必须确保用户数据的安全和隐私保护,同时优化登录过程中的用户体验,避免因登录问题带来不必要的用户流失。

相关阅读

推荐文章

热门文章